Question 1
A 68-year-old male with a past medical history of heart failure with reduced
ejection fraction (HFrEF), hypertension, and chronic kidney disease stage 3 (eGFR
45 mL/min/1.73m²) presents to the clinic with worsening dyspnea and fatigue. His
current medications include lisinopril 20 mg daily, furosemide 40 mg daily, and
carvedilol 6.25 mg twice daily. Vital signs: BP 142/88 mmHg, HR 78 bpm, weight
increased 5 kg since last visit. Which of the following is the MOST appropriate
addition to his regimen?
A. Spironolactone 25 mg daily
B. Sacubitril/valsartan 24/26 mg twice daily
C. Digoxin 0.125 mg daily
D. Hydralazine 25 mg three times daily
,Answer: B. Sacubitril/valsartan 24/26 mg twice daily
Rationale: Sacubitril/valsartan is recommended for patients with HFrEF (NYHA
class II-III) who remain symptomatic despite optimal therapy with an ACE
inhibitor (or ARB), beta-blocker, and diuretic. It has been shown to reduce
cardiovascular death and heart failure hospitalizations compared to enalapril. The
PARADIGM-HF trial demonstrated superiority of sacubitril/valsartan over
enalapril. The patient is already on an ACE inhibitor (lisinopril) and beta-blocker
(carvedilol). Before initiating sacubitril/valsartan, the ACE inhibitor must be
discontinued for 36 hours to reduce the risk of angioedema. Spironolactone would
be appropriate but is typically added after optimizing ACE inhibitor and beta-
blocker; however, sacubitril/valsartan provides greater benefit. Digoxin is not first-
line. Hydralazine is indicated primarily in African American patients with HFrEF
already on optimal therapy.
Question 2
A 72-year-old female with atrial fibrillation is started on warfarin for stroke
prevention. Her INR is 2.8 on a stable dose. She is prescribed amiodarone for rate
control. Which of the following is the most appropriate monitoring adjustment?
A. No change in warfarin dose needed
B. Reduce warfarin dose by 30-50% and monitor INR closely
C. Increase warfarin dose by 30-50%
D. Discontinue warfarin and start apixaban
Answer: B. Reduce warfarin dose by 30-50% and monitor INR closely
Rationale: Amiodarone is a potent inhibitor of CYP2C9 and CYP3A4, which
metabolize warfarin. Additionally, amiodarone displaces warfarin from protein-
binding sites, further increasing the anticoagulant effect. The combination
significantly increases INR and bleeding risk. The warfarin dose should typically
be reduced by 30-50% when amiodarone is initiated, with close INR monitoring.
The full interaction may take 1-2 weeks to manifest. Apixaban could be
considered, but the question asks about adjusting the current regimen.
Question 3
A 55-year-old male with Type 2 diabetes mellitus, hypertension, and
,hyperlipidemia presents for follow-up. His HbA1c is 8.2% despite metformin
1,000 mg twice daily. His eGFR is 52 mL/min/1.73m². Which of the following is
the MOST appropriate addition to his regimen?
A. Glipizide 5 mg daily
B. Empagliflozin 10 mg daily
C. Pioglitazone 15 mg daily
D. Sitagliptin 100 mg daily
Answer: B. Empagliflozin 10 mg daily
Rationale: Empagliflozin (an SGLT2 inhibitor) is preferred as add-on therapy to
metformin in patients with Type 2 diabetes and cardiovascular disease or chronic
kidney disease, as it has demonstrated cardiovascular and renal benefits in the
EMPA-REG OUTCOME trial. The patient has hypertension and early CKD
(eGFR 52), making empagliflozin an excellent choice. It provides cardiovascular
mortality benefit, reduces heart failure hospitalizations, and slows progression of
renal disease. Glipizide (sulfonylurea) provides glycemic control but no
cardiovascular benefit and may cause hypoglycemia and weight gain. Pioglitazone
is useful but has fluid retention concerns and is not preferred in patients with heart
failure risk. Sitagliptin is safe but does not offer the cardiovascular and renal
benefits of SGLT2 inhibitors.
Question 4
A 45-year-old female with no significant past medical history presents with a
urinary tract infection. Urine culture grows Escherichia coli susceptible to
nitrofurantoin, trimethoprim-sulfamethoxazole, and ciprofloxacin. Her serum
creatinine is 1.1 mg/dL (eGFR 62 mL/min/1.73m²). Which of the following is the
MOST appropriate antibiotic choice?
A. Nitrofurantoin 100 mg twice daily for 5 days
B. Trimethoprim-sulfamethoxazole DS twice daily for 3 days
C. Ciprofloxacin 500 mg twice daily for 7 days
D. Nitrofurantoin 100 mg four times daily for 7 days
Answer: A. Nitrofurantoin 100 mg twice daily for 5 days
Rationale: For uncomplicated cystitis in a female, nitrofurantoin is a first-line
agent, effective against E. coli. The recommended regimen is 100 mg twice daily
, for 5 days. Nitrofurantoin requires a minimum CrCl > 60 mL/min; this patient's
eGFR is 62 mL/min/1.73m², which is borderline, so it remains appropriate with
monitoring. TMP-SMX is also first-line but resistance rates among E. coli are
increasing (>20% in many regions), making it less reliable without susceptibility
confirmation. Ciprofloxacin is effective but is generally reserved for complicated
UTIs or when other agents cannot be used due to its broader collateral effects and
resistance concerns. Nitrofurantoin is preferred for uncomplicated cystitis due to
minimal systemic side effects and low resistance rates.
Question 5
A 62-year-old male with a history of COPD (GOLD Group D) presents with
increased dyspnea, sputum production, and cough. He is currently on tiotropium 18
mcg daily and albuterol PRN. Which of the following is the MOST appropriate
addition to his maintenance regimen?
A. Fluticasone/salmeterol 250/50 twice daily
B. Theophylline 300 mg twice daily
C. Montelukast 10 mg daily
D. Azithromycin 250 mg daily
Answer: A. Fluticasone/salmeterol 250/50 twice daily
Rationale: For patients with COPD GOLD Group D (high symptom burden and
high exacerbation risk), the GOLD guidelines recommend initiating a
LABA/LAMA combination, and for patients with an eosinophil count ≥ 300
cells/μL, adding an ICS to the LABA/LAMA regimen. Fluticasone/salmeterol is an
ICS/LABA combination that would address both the symptom burden and
exacerbation risk. This patient is already on a LAMA (tiotropium), so adding an
ICS/LABA is appropriate. Theophylline is a third-line agent with significant
toxicity and drug interactions. Montelukast is not indicated for COPD.
Azithromycin may be considered for exacerbation prevention in select patients but
is not first-line and requires QT monitoring.
